Overview of Ford EcoSport

The Ford EcoSport was first introduced in 2003 and has evolved significantly over the years. Known for its compact size and practicality, the EcoSport is designed for urban environments while also offering versatility for outdoor adventures. Its design features a high ground clearance and a distinctive rear swing gate that sets it apart from competitors.

Key Features of Ford EcoSport

  • Engine Options: The EcoSport offers a range of engines, including a 1.0-liter turbocharged inline-3 and a 2.0-liter inline-4, providing a balance of power and fuel efficiency.
  • Interior Space: The EcoSport features a spacious interior with flexible seating arrangements and ample cargo space, making it suitable for families and individuals alike.
  • Technology: Equipped with Ford’s SYNC infotainment system, the EcoSport includes features such as smartphone integration, navigation, and a premium audio system.

Overview of Mazda CX-3

The Mazda CX-3, launched in 2015, is known for its sporty handling and stylish design. It combines the functionality of an SUV with the agility of a compact car. The CX-3 is often praised for its upscale interior and engaging driving dynamics, appealing to those who prioritize performance and aesthetics.

Key Features of Mazda CX-3

  • Engine Performance: The CX-3 is powered by a 2.0-liter inline-4 engine, delivering responsive acceleration and impressive fuel economy.
  • Interior Quality: With high-quality materials and a driver-focused layout, the CX-3 offers a premium feel that rivals larger SUVs.
  • Safety Features: The CX-3 comes equipped with advanced safety technologies, including blind-spot monitoring and rear cross-traffic alert, enhancing driver confidence.

Comparative Analysis

When comparing the Ford EcoSport and Mazda CX-3, several factors come into play, including performance, interior quality, technology, and overall value.

Performance

The EcoSport offers a choice of engines, which can be advantageous for buyers seeking either efficiency or power. The turbocharged engine provides a punchy performance, especially in city driving. In contrast, the CX-3’s single engine option is tuned for a sportier driving experience, making it more fun to drive on winding roads.

Interior Quality

While both vehicles provide comfortable seating and adequate space, the Mazda CX-3 stands out with its upscale materials and refined design. The EcoSport, while practical, may not feel as luxurious in comparison. However, the EcoSport compensates with its versatile cargo options.

Technology and Features

Both models are equipped with modern technology, but the EcoSport’s SYNC system offers more extensive features for connectivity. The CX-3, however, includes a more intuitive interface and a premium sound system, appealing to tech-savvy buyers.

Value for Money

In terms of pricing, the Ford EcoSport often comes at a lower entry point, making it an attractive option for budget-conscious buyers. The Mazda CX-3, while typically more expensive, offers a higher perceived value due to its premium features and sporty performance.
